本文目录导读:
分布式存储概述
分布式存储是一种基于网络连接的存储技术,通过将数据分散存储在多个物理设备上,实现数据的高可用性、高可靠性和高性能,在云计算、大数据、物联网等领域,分布式存储已成为不可或缺的技术之一。
分布式存储设备
1、硬件设备
(1)存储服务器:存储服务器是分布式存储系统中的核心设备,负责存储数据的读写、备份、恢复等功能,根据需求,可以选择不同性能的存储服务器。
(2)存储阵列:存储阵列是多个硬盘组成的集合体,具有高密度、高性能的特点,根据容量和性能需求,可以选择不同类型的存储阵列。
图片来源于网络,如有侵权联系删除
(3)网络设备:网络设备包括交换机、路由器等,负责数据传输和路由,在分布式存储系统中,网络设备需要具备高带宽、低延迟的特点。
2、软件设备
(1)文件系统:文件系统是分布式存储系统的基础,负责管理文件的存储、访问和备份,常见的文件系统有HDFS、GlusterFS等。
(2)分布式文件系统:分布式文件系统是一种在多个物理设备上存储文件的系统,具有高可用性、高性能等特点,常见的分布式文件系统有Ceph、GlusterFS等。
(3)数据复制和同步工具:数据复制和同步工具负责在分布式存储系统中实现数据的一致性,常见的工具有rsync、NFS等。
分布式存储架构
1、主从架构:主从架构是一种常见的分布式存储架构,其中主节点负责数据的存储和备份,从节点负责数据的读取和写入。
2、对等架构:对等架构是一种去中心化的分布式存储架构,所有节点都具有相同的职责,相互之间进行数据交换。
图片来源于网络,如有侵权联系删除
3、混合架构:混合架构结合了主从架构和对等架构的优点,既能保证数据的高可用性,又能提高系统性能。
分布式存储应用场景
1、大数据存储:分布式存储系统可以高效地存储和分析大规模数据,适用于云计算、大数据等领域。
2、物联网:分布式存储系统可以存储大量的物联网数据,为物联网应用提供数据支持。
3、云计算:分布式存储系统可以提高云服务的性能和可靠性,为云用户提供优质的服务。
4、文件共享:分布式存储系统可以实现文件的集中存储和共享,提高工作效率。
分布式存储入门实践
1、学习基础知识:了解分布式存储的基本概念、原理、架构和应用场景。
2、选择合适的分布式存储系统:根据实际需求,选择合适的分布式存储系统,如HDFS、Ceph等。
图片来源于网络,如有侵权联系删除
3、安装和配置:按照分布式存储系统的官方文档,进行安装和配置。
4、编写应用程序:使用分布式存储系统提供的API,编写应用程序实现数据存储和访问。
5、性能优化:根据实际应用场景,对分布式存储系统进行性能优化,提高系统性能。
6、安全保障:确保分布式存储系统的数据安全,采取相应的安全措施,如数据加密、访问控制等。
分布式存储技术具有广泛的应用前景,掌握分布式存储设备、架构和应用场景,有助于在云计算、大数据等领域发挥重要作用,通过学习分布式存储入门实践,可以逐步提高自己的技术水平,为我国分布式存储技术的发展贡献力量。
标签: #分布式存储怎么入手
评论列表